Camera isn't functioning

  1. If the screen shows a closed lens or black image, force quit the Camera app.
  2. If you do not see the Camera app on the Home screen, try searching for it in Spotlight. If the camera does not show up in the search, check to make sure that Restrictions are not turned on by tappingSettings > General > Restrictions.
  3. Ensure the camera lens is clean and free from any obstructions. Use a microfiber polishing cloth to clean the lens.
  4. Third-party cases can interfere with the autofocus/exposure feature and the flash (iPhone 4 only); try removing the case if you have image-quality issues with photos.
  5. Try turning iPhone off and then back on.
  6. Tap to focus the camera on the subject. The image may pulse or briefly go in and out of focus as it adjusts.
  7. Try to remain steady while focusing:
    • Still images: Remain steady while taking the picture. If you move too far in any direction, the camera automatically refocuses to the center. Note: If you take a picture with iPhone turned sideways, it is automatically saved in landscape orientation.
    • Video: Adjust focus before you begin recording. After recording begins, you cannot readjust focus until you stop recording. Exiting the Camera application while recording will stop recording and will save the video to the Camera Roll. Note: Video-recording features are not available on original iPhone or iPhone 3G.
  8. If your iPhone has a front and rear camera, try switching between them to verify if the issue persists on both.

that simply will not work and it is not a workaround by any means. If the camera shows purple screen or purple streaks - it is done and it doesn't matter what application will use that API in iOS - iOS hands over to the app the same broken device, a rear facing camera, that is.


Take the device to a local Apple or talk to Apple representative via phone/chat. If you reset your phone and it still does the same - it is a hardware problem and it needs to be fix by Apple.

Here's what worked for me (twice). Same symptoms as most others. Front camera works fine, rear camera doesn't but when switching from front to rear kind of "freezes" a blurry image and then gets stuck. Other things work such as being able to slide from photo to video...sort of...but get more and more sluggish and eventually they freeze up too. This EXACT same thing happened on both my iPhone 4s and now my 5S. The first time, after trying EVERYTHING I came across online over several panic-stricken days, I finally took it to the Apple store where they determined it must be a hardware problem BUT they had no replacement in stock at that time. Took it back home (since the rest of the phone did work) left the phone plugged in with the camera on and voila. Worked fine the next day and ever since.


When the same thing happened with my iphone 5S I, once again, panicked and searched anew for a solution for several days. Occurred to me last night what worked the last time: LEAVE IT PLUGGED IN WITH THE CAMERA "ON" OVERNIGHT. I sure was a happy camper this morning. Works fine.

I had the same problem... I think I figured out. It is a hardware problem, no doubt about it. HOW TO SOLVE IT?

Apply pressure over the rear lens CAREFULLY and then clean it. This will solve the poor contact the lens is making and will return back your camera.

It works fine for me... probably will fail sometimes, so you will have to apply the same pressure again...no way. I hope this works for you !
